Vadim nemkov He remains unstoppable in MMA. Last Saturday (13), in France, the feared Russian showed no mercy to the giant. Renan Problem. finished in the first round and won the inaugural PFL heavyweight (up to 120,2 kg) belt. Excited by the important victory, the pupil of the legendary... Fedor Emelianenko He has already defined his next target.
In short, Nemkov challenged Francis Ngannou, a PFL star, is set for a super fight. Interestingly, the Russian is being called a giant hunter because he excelled in the light heavyweight division (up to 93 kg) and now, in the heavyweight division, is finding success against much larger, stronger, and more powerful athletes.

Not surprisingly, the fighter is considered by many to be one of the best outside the UFC. Therefore, Nemkov, in top form, is confident that he can not only face the feared Cameroonian, who last fought in 2024, on equal terms, but also beat him.
“I’ll fight whoever the PFL wants. But I really want to fight Ngannou,” said the PFL champion in the post-fight interview.
Nemkov's Curriculum Vitae
Vadim nemkovThe 33-year-old began his MMA career in 2013 and stood out in Bellator, PFL, and Rizin. In his career, the Russian has won 19 fights, lost twice, and one ended in a no contest.
Ward of Fedor EmelianenkoThe athlete was the Bellator light heavyweight champion and has now won the PFL heavyweight title. His most important victories were against... Bruno Cappelozza, Corey anderson, Phil Davis (twice), Renan Problem, Ryan bader e Yoel romero.
